Who’s ready for the return of another classic holiday tradition? The Burnaby Village Museum is soon transforming into a 10-acre Christmas village, complete with seasonal entertainment, interactive demos, and delightful treats. Oh, and it’s completely free to attend!
Guests can roam the open-air museum at their leisure, taking in a variety of large holiday light installations and displays.
From seasonal scavenger hunts and festive live music to illuminated jugglers and “Stories on Wheels,” there are plenty of family-friendly activities and entertainment to look forward to this year.
And if you get hungry, you can treat yourself to a meal or treat at the new Mai’s Cafe (formerly the Ice Cream Parlour), or one of the on-site food trucks.

Plus, on Saturday, December 2nd, Heritage Christmas will have an official launch ceremony with a special tree lighting at 6 pm. So don’t miss out!
Note that carousel rides are $2.52 per ride, or $30.24 for 13 rides.

When: Now until January 5th
Where: 6501 Deer Lake Avenue, Burnaby
Cost: Free admission
